A man accused of vandalizing two LGBTQ-owned businesses in Lexington, Ky. was arrested on Wednesday, local authorities said. William White, 52, was charged with first- and second-degree criminal mischief as well as charges for an outstanding warrant, according to the Lexington Police Department.
